This chapter delves into the complexities of cancel culture, focusing on its societal implications, themes of forgiveness, and the consequences of online expressions. Through personal anecdotes, it examines whether cancel culture stifles open dialogue or enforces accountability, ultimately questioning the potential for redemption in a scrutinized digital landscape.
